Elizabeth Spencer is proud that this Cabernet Sauvignon is recognized by the California Certified Organic Farmers (CCOF), a nonprofit organization that advances organic agriculture for a healthy world through organic certification, education, advocacy, and promotion.

Wine Production

Select lots of Cabernet Sauvignon are harvested and blended to develop complexity before being aged in primarily French oak barrels. 

accordion plus icons
About the Vineyard

This wine is made from carefully selected Cabernet Sauvignon grape grown in the prestigious Boisset Estate California Certified Organic Farmers (CCOF) Vineyards in St. Helena and Rutherford.
